Many people ask:

ā€œAfter my H-1B is withdrawn or revoked, will I receive a notice from USCIS? And what will my Case Status show when I check it using the receipt number?ā€


Actually, the follow-up notices and Case StatusĀ can be different depending on whether the H-1B had already been approved or was still pending when the employer requested the withdrawal.


Today, Attorney Xiaozeng will walk through real-world casesĀ involving two different situations: an already-approved H-1BĀ and an H-1B that was still pendingĀ when the employer requested the withdrawal.


1ļøāƒ£ H-1B was already approved, and the employer requests withdrawal after the employee leaves

In this situation, the notice issued by USCIS is typically titled:

ā€œRevocation of Nonimmigrant Petition: Automatic Revocationā€(See Figure 2)

Let’s first look at the timeline of this case (Figures 2 & 3):

šŸ“… May 27, 2026:Ā USCIS received the employer’s withdrawal request.šŸ“… June 2, 2026:Ā USCIS mailed the revocation confirmation notice.


It took less than one week, which is very fast.


However, this case was filed with premium processing, which may explain the relatively quick processing time.


Why do we say that?


Let’s look at another case in Figures 4 and 5. Again, the H-1B had already been approved, and the employer subsequently requested withdrawal:


šŸ“… January 5, 2026:Ā USCIS received the withdrawal request.šŸ“… May 5, 2026:Ā USCIS finally mailed the revocation confirmation notice.

That’s a full four monthsĀ between the two dates.

But there is one very important detail:

šŸ‘‰ Even though the revocation confirmation notice was not mailed until May, USCIS confirmed that the Automatic Revocation effective date was January 5—the date USCIS received the withdrawal request, notĀ the date the confirmation notice was mailed.


Also, Case Tracker typically does not show exactly when USCIS received the withdrawal request.


You generally need to look at the official USCIS noticeĀ to confirm that date.


2ļøāƒ£ H-1B was still pending, and the employer requests withdrawal

In this situation, the notice is different from the first scenario.


As shown in Figure 6, the notice is simply titled:

ā€œWithdrawalā€

USCIS will formally confirm that the H-1B petition has been withdrawn.

However, this notice may not necessarily state the exact date USCIS received the withdrawal request.


The Case Status timeline can be referenced in Figure 7.

ā€¼ļø So, in simple terms:

H-1B already approved → employer withdraws it → Automatic Revocation

H-1B still pending → employer withdraws it → Withdrawal


šŸ“Œ The key is to first determine whether the H-1B had already been approved when the employer requested the withdrawal.
